Discover the Power of ChatGPT's New Memory Feature
ChatGPT has just released one of its most important updates - the ability to reference all your previous chats, allowing it to provide personalized responses. This new feature, called "reference chat history," gives ChatGPT a memory that can be leveraged to make your conversations more practical and efficient.
With this update, ChatGPT can now access your past chat history and use that information to tailor its responses. This means you don't have to repeat yourself as much, and ChatGPT can build upon your previous conversations. The previous memory was limited, but this new "reference chat history" feature provides an infinite way to reference your old chats.
In addition to the "reference chat history," ChatGPT also has a "reference saved memory" feature, which allows you to manually save specific information about yourself that ChatGPT can recall in future conversations. This gives you more control over the information ChatGPT remembers about you.
To take advantage of these new memory features, you can use prompts like "Describe me based on all our chats" or "Remember my core product pitch for Skill Leap." ChatGPT will then use its reference chat history and saved memory to provide a personalized response. You can also ask ChatGPT to track your marketing experiments and save that information for future reference.
These new memory features make ChatGPT a much more practical and useful tool, allowing you to build upon your previous conversations and save time by not having to repeat yourself. With the ability to reference your chat history and save specific information, ChatGPT is becoming an even more powerful and versatile AI assistant.

Manage Your Saved Memories and Chat History
The new reference memory feature in ChatGPT allows you to leverage your past conversations to get more personalized and contextual responses. Here's how you can manage your saved memories and chat history:
-
Saved Memories: This is the old memory function where you could explicitly ask ChatGPT to remember specific information about you. You can view, edit, and delete these saved memories by going to the "Manage Memory" tab in the settings.
-
Reference Chat History: This is the new and powerful feature that allows ChatGPT to reference your entire chat history to provide more relevant responses. Unlike the saved memories, there is no limit to the chat history that can be referenced.
-
Deleting Specific Memories: If there's any information you don't want ChatGPT to remember, you can simply ask it to "forget" that part, and it will remove it from your saved memories.
-
Deleting Chat History: To remove references to specific past conversations, you'll need to delete the chat history itself using the three-dot menu next to the chat.
-
Privacy Considerations: While the reference chat history can be very useful, it's important to be mindful of the type of information you share, especially anything sensitive or personal. You can use the "Temporary Chat" mode to have conversations that won't be stored in your history or memory.
-
Suggested Memories: Based on your past conversations, ChatGPT can provide a list of 10 things it recommends you store in your saved memories. Review this list and save any relevant information for future use.
Remember, the new reference memory features are designed to make your interactions with ChatGPT more personalized and efficient. Leverage them to streamline your workflows and avoid repeating yourself, but also be mindful of your privacy and the information you choose to share.

Protect Your Privacy with Temporary Chats
When it comes to privacy and safety considerations around the new memory features in ChatGPT, the platform provides an important option - temporary chats.
By using the "Temporary Chat" mode, you can have a conversation with ChatGPT without having it stored in your chat history or affecting the model's memory. This is a great way to discuss sensitive information or topics you don't want permanently associated with your account.
When in Temporary Chat mode, ChatGPT will not retain any details from the conversation, nor will it use that information to train the model. This allows you to have a private, one-off interaction without impacting your regular ChatGPT usage.
To access Temporary Chat, simply click the "New Conversation" button at the top and select the "Temporary Chat" option. This will start a fresh conversation that won't be saved or affect your normal ChatGPT experience.
Remember, while the reference chat history feature is powerful, it's important to be mindful of the types of information you share with ChatGPT. By utilizing the Temporary Chat mode when needed, you can enjoy the benefits of ChatGPT's memory while maintaining your privacy and security.
